Neighborhood Overview
Lalayo Park is situated in the vibrant community of Laplace, Louisiana, a key hub within St. John the Baptist Parish. Easily accessible via major roadways, the park is conveniently located near the intersection of Interstate 10 and Highway 3127, making it a straightforward destination for local and visiting groups. Parking is primarily available in designated lots directly around the park's main sports fields and activity areas. For those arriving from further afield, Louis Armstrong New Orleans International Airport (MSY) is approximately a 30-40 minute drive northeast, depending on traffic. Public transportation options are limited in this area, so planning your arrival via personal vehicle, rideshare, or pre-arranged team transport is recommended. To avoid congestion, especially during peak event times or weekend games, consider arriving at least 30-45 minutes before your scheduled activity to secure parking and navigate to your specific location within the park.

Weather & Seasons
Winter
Winter in Laplace is typically mild, with daytime temperatures often pleasant for outdoor activities. Average highs might hover in the 50s and 60s Fahrenheit. You’ll want to pack layers, including a light jacket or sweatshirt, as mornings and evenings can be cooler. This season generally offers clear skies and less humidity, making it an excellent time for sports and park visits without extreme weather concerns.
Spring & early summer
Spring brings warming temperatures and increasing humidity, with averages rising into the 70s and 80s Fahrenheit. This is a prime season for outdoor events and sports. Light, breathable clothing is recommended. Occasional spring showers are possible, so packing a light raincoat or umbrella could be beneficial for any unexpected downpours. Sunscreen and hats are increasingly important as the sun’s intensity grows.
Mid-summer
Summers in Laplace are hot and humid, with temperatures frequently exceeding the 90s Fahrenheit and high humidity making it feel even warmer. Lightweight, moisture-wicking clothing is essential. Plan outdoor activities for early mornings or late evenings to avoid the peak heat. Staying well-hydrated is critical; carry plenty of water and seek shade whenever possible. Sun protection, including sunscreen and hats, is non-negotiable.
Fall season
Fall offers a welcome reprieve from summer heat, with temperatures gradually cooling into the 60s and 70s Fahrenheit. This transition period is ideal for comfortable outdoor recreation. Light layers are usually sufficient, such as long-sleeved shirts or a light sweater for cooler mornings and evenings. Humidity also begins to decrease, making park visits more pleasant. It's a beautiful time to enjoy the park's scenery.
Rain & snow
Rainfall is common throughout the year in Laplace, with thunderstorms possible, especially in spring and summer. Pack a compact umbrella or poncho. Snow is extremely rare in this region. When rain occurs, especially heavily, it can impact field conditions, potentially leading to cancellations or delays for outdoor sports. Check event status if inclement weather is forecast.
